Fabio Franchino, Developer in Turin, Metropolitan City of Turin, Italy
Fabio is available for hire
Hire Fabio

Fabio Franchino

Verified Expert  in Engineering

Front-end Developer

Turin, Metropolitan City of Turin, Italy

Toptal member since April 21, 2021

Bio

Fabio is a senior front-end engineer, specializing in high-performant and data-driven visualization applications, with expertise in React, Vue.js, and D3.js. With strong UX skills and an eye for effective user interfaces, Fabio has led and collaborated with teams of designers, developers, and scientists to deliver solutions. With experience as an agency CTO and as a freelancer, and his passion for clear communication, Fabio wears the right hat to ease team communication and maximize performance.

Portfolio

Freelance
Vue, React, D3.js, Figma, GitHub, MacOS, User Experience (UX)...
TOP-IX Consortium
D3.js, Data Visualization, JavaScript, ECMAScript (ES6), MacOS, Git
Idexè
CSS, HTML5, Vue, ECMAScript (ES6), Netlify, User Interface (UI)

Experience

Availability

Part-time

Preferred Environment

GitHub, Netlify, Firebase, MacOS

The most amazing...

...project I've led was the front-end development of Arduino Create, the cloud- based code editor for microcontrollers that's used by millions of people.

Work Experience

Senior Front-end Engineer

2019 - 2021
Freelance
  • Developed several data-driven and visualization dashboard applications, allowing internal big data explorations by financial specialists for one of the largest Italian banks.
  • Contributed to UX implementations, refining interactions to solve user flow issues.
  • Collaborated with back-end developers and data scientists to design the API infrastructure in order to achieve the desired performance.
Technologies: Vue, React, D3.js, Figma, GitHub, MacOS, User Experience (UX), Interaction Design (IxD), Git, User Interface (UI)

Data Visualization Technical Instructor

2011 - 2021
TOP-IX Consortium
  • Designed and developed a technical data visualization course, including exercises, prototypes, and step-by-step proofs of concepts used during the course.
  • Taught and mentored an international and highly skilled class, typically PhD candidates, providing them with practical skills to create data-driven and interactive applications.
  • Assessed the students' knowledge through interviews and practical tests to provide further guidance and advice.
Technologies: D3.js, Data Visualization, JavaScript, ECMAScript (ES6), MacOS, Git

Senior Front-end Developer

2018 - 2019
Idexè
  • Designed and developed the front end of the client's eCommerce platform from scratch.
  • Optimized the platform's performance over time with continuous analytical measurements of user access and interaction tracking information.
  • Monitored and scaled the infrastructure during specific peak access periods to avoid system outages that would preclude user purchases.
Technologies: CSS, HTML5, Vue, ECMAScript (ES6), Netlify, User Interface (UI)

CTO

2007 - 2018
TODO s.r.l
  • Managed the company's production team—four software developers and three designers—at the crossroad of design and coding to deliver top-notch software solutions using Agile methodology.
  • Led the front-end development of Arduino's cloud-based code editor, which millions of people use to program microcontrollers.
  • Oversaw the development of a cluster of interactive software for exhibit purposes for the Enel pavilion in the Expo 2015 global fair.
  • Led the design and development of a public, data-driven visualization dashboard for Nesta UK's Digital Social Innovation for Europe network (DSI4EU) project.
  • Managed the development and deployment of several interactive software applications for exhibit purposes at Mozilla's MozFest 2016.
  • Oversaw the development and deployment of an interactive application, Codemoji, for Mozilla in the context of a global communication campaign.
  • Led the development and deployment of several diverse software applications for the opening of Turin's new Egyptian museum, Museo Egizio.
Technologies: Vue, D3.js, Three.js, React, CSS, HTML5, JavaScript, ECMAScript (ES6), Basecamp, GitHub, Netlify, Firebase, MacOS, User Experience (UX), Interaction Design (IxD), Figma, Git, Management, Full-stack, REST APIs, MySQL, Node.js, User Interface (UI)

Presenta Platform

A collection of libraries and tools allowing people to create web presentations in seconds, using a data-driven approach. The platform includes an open-source library, playground tool, and public configurator. A private SaaS is in development.

Data Visualization Dashboard

A tailor-made, highly configurable, performant, and data-driven dashboard to visualize financial big data information and allow users to perform several data operations, such as filtering and aggregation, in real time. I developed the front-end software using the React stack. One of the most challenging features was the design and implementation of the parallel data fetch and client-side cache to enhance the user experience from a performance point of view.

Cloud-based Code Editor

A state-of-the-art, cloud-based code editor for microcontrollers, integrated with several product-related services. I was the lead front-end developer and contributed to designing and implementing the front-end code with Vue.js.

Digital Signage System

A custom digital signage system integrated with an internal back office. It allows a company to handle internal communication across several departments, using a single, easy-to-use interface to manage content and assets and monitor configurations. I developed the whole system, from the front-end to the server-side scripts, in order to manage the system integration.
1996 - 2000

Bachelor's Degree in Communication and Computer Graphics

Polytechnic University of Turin - Turin, Italy

Libraries/APIs

D3.js, Vue, React, Three.js, Node.js, REST APIs

Tools

GitHub, Git, Vue CLI, Figma, Basecamp

Languages

CSS, HTML5, JavaScript, HTML, ECMAScript (ES6)

Paradigms

Management, UX Design

Platforms

MacOS, Netlify, Firebase, Amazon Web Services (AWS)

Storage

MySQL

Other

User Experience (UX), Interaction Design (IxD), Data Visualization, Full-stack, User Interface (UI)

Collaboration That Works

How to Work with Toptal

Toptal matches you directly with global industry experts from our network in hours—not weeks or months.

1

Share your needs

Discuss your requirements and refine your scope in a call with a Toptal domain expert.
2

Choose your talent

Get a short list of expertly matched talent within 24 hours to review, interview, and choose from.
3

Start your risk-free talent trial

Work with your chosen talent on a trial basis for up to two weeks. Pay only if you decide to hire them.

Top talent is in high demand.

Start hiring